Authenticity
A lot of electric fireplaces are designed to recreate the atmosphere of real flames creating a peaceful atmosphere which is ideal for slowing down or entertaining. Some do this very well and others fail to impress. No matter if it's an older mist system or a brand new generation of holographic technology, the goal is to create a mesmerizing fire that can be used all year long. The good news is the quality of these systems has significantly improved over the past few years. The top models feature flame effects that are so realistic you may have to look twice to verify that it isn't real.
One of the most common methods to achieve realistic flames in an electric fire set-up is LED lighting and various projection techniques. The flames are usually colored with different shades of yellow, while stencil projection creates crisp edges. Many of the most well-known units use a matte black backing to let the flames stand out in any room lighting.
Other models, such as the Hastings Home Electric Fireplace, have a partially-frosted glass back which allows you to see through it into the masonry hearth to add realism. The unit has a remote that can switch it off or on and regulate the flame, heat and the ember colors.
Some fireplaces with electric features include sounds that resemble the crackling of a wood burning fire to make the most of the simulated flames. Some have a dimmer setting that lets you alter the intensity of the flames that simulate.
The Opti-V Solo built-in electric fireplace from Dimplex offers a unique way to create realistic flames using the latest screen and glass surface projection technology. This top-of-the-line model uses a series of high-resolution screens that play a video of a real flame on loop, with effects such as flickering smoke and embers that pop. The unit also comes with a cool-touch exterior as well as overheat protection that makes it safe to touch and place objects on the top of.

The price of an electric fire suite can be done by determining the number of hours a day you'll need to use it. You'll need to know the wattage your fireplace and how much electricity you're charged per hour. For instance, the Celsi Ultiflame VR Elara has a wattage of 1600, so it consumes around 1.6kWh per hour. This is equivalent to around 50 pence. If you do this calculation, you can easily figure out how much the suite will cost to run.
